linux centos 添加创建用户并设置权限

2021-05-10 14:22:24 浏览数 (1)

# 创建用户案例

#新增普通用户 并登录ssh #

#groupadd eisc # 新建test工作组

useradd -g root eisc -d /eisc # 创建用户eisc是root群组,登录目录是 /eisc

echo "aaaassss" | passwd --stdin eisc # --stdin 指定用户更改密码:echo打印密码用管道将密码配置用户密码

# usermod -G groupname username # 给已有的用户增加工作组

NR=`cat -n /etc/sudoers | grep root | grep ALL | awk -F" " '{print $1}'`

# 定义一个变量NR,命令查看 root 的行号

sed -i "$NR aeisc ALL=(ALL) ALL" /etc/sudoers

# 授权规则是分配权限的执行规则

# 用户权限

vi /etc/sudoers

# User privilege specification

root ALL=(ALL) ALL # root 表示用户

# Members of the admin group may gain root privileges

�min ALL=(ALL) ALL # admin 用户组(% 名表示给用户组设置权限)

# 第一个ALL:多个系统之间部署 sudo 环境时,ALL所有主机。也可以指定主机名

# 第二个ALL(即括号内的):表示user用户能够以任何用户的身份执行命令

# 第三个ALL:能够执行系统中的所有命令# 创建用户案例

#新增普通用户 并登录ssh #

#groupadd eisc # 新建test工作组

useradd -g root eisc -d /eisc # 创建用户eisc是root群组,登录目录是 /eisc

echo "aaaassss" | passwd --stdin eisc # --stdin 指定用户更改密码:echo打印密码用管道将密码配置用户密码

# usermod -G groupname username # 给已有的用户增加工作组

NR=`cat -n /etc/sudoers | grep root | grep ALL | awk -F" " '{print $1}'`

# 定义一个变量NR,命令查看 root 的行号

sed -i "$NR aeisc ALL=(ALL) ALL" /etc/sudoers

# 授权规则是分配权限的执行规则

# 用户权限

vi /etc/sudoers

# User privilege specification

root ALL=(ALL) ALL # root 表示用户

# Members of the admin group may gain root privileges

�min ALL=(ALL) ALL # admin 用户组(% 名表示给用户组设置权限)

# 第一个ALL:多个系统之间部署 sudo 环境时,ALL所有主机。也可以指定主机名

# 第二个ALL(即括号内的):表示user用户能够以任何用户的身份执行命令

# 第三个ALL:能够执行系统中的所有命令

0 人点赞